display sslvpn context

Use display sslvpn context to display SSL VPN context information.
Syntax
display sslvpn context [ brief | name context-name ]
Views
Any view
Predefined user roles
network-admin
network-operator
Parameters
brief: Displays brief SSL VPN context information. If you do not specify this keyword, the command
displays detailed SSL VPN context information.
name context-name: Specifies an SSL VPN context by its name. An SSL VPN context name is a
case-insensitive string of 1 to 31 characters, and can contain only letters, digits, and underscores (_).
If you do not specify an SSL VPN context, this command displays information about all SSL VPN
contexts.
Examples
# Display detailed information about all SSL VPN contexts.

Abbreviated interface name.
Physical link state of the interface:
UP—The link is physically up.
DOWN—The link is physically down.
ADM—The interface has been shut down by using the shutdown
command. To restore the physical state of the interface, use the undo
shutdown command.
Data link layer protocol state of the interface:
UP—The data link protocol state of the interface is up.
UP(s)—The data link protocol state of the interface is up, but the link
is temporarily set up on demand or does not exist. This attribute is
available for null interfaces and loopback interfaces.
DOWN—The data link protocol state of the interface is down.
Primary IP address of the interface.
Description for the interface.
Causes for the physical state of DOWN:
Administratively—The link has been shut down by using the
shutdown command. To bring it up, use the undo shutdown
command.
Not connected—No physical connection exists.
